Price Range & Condition
The condition of a property plays an important role in determining its value, with the degree of impact varying by property type, size and location.
For 296, Seaside, Eastbourne, we estimate a market value of £272,948 and a rental value of £1,476 per month when presented in very good decorative order. Should the property require extensive cosmetic improvement, those figures would reduce to £241,754 and £1,307 per month respectively.

Energy Efficiency
296, Seaside, Eastbourne has an Energy Performance Rating (EPC) of D. This is based on the most recent assessment, dated 16 Oct 2020.
The property is connected to mains gas and has fully double glazed windows. It is heated using a boiler and radiators (mains gas).
